What can I do with my area carpet fringe when it gets old and dirty?

Many of our customers ask us this question so we took a look at all of the newer area rugs on the market.  We noticed the fringe on the newer rugs is no longer.  We are honestly suggesting to any client with fringe problems to simply cut it off evenly.  They do make products for cleaning this but the process takes weeks and can be very costly so we don’t provide it.  On top of that it is a fading style so most people want to get rid of it anyway.  The only time I would say not to cut it off is if it is a valuable rug and this will take away value from the piece.  As always if you have any questions or problems just give us a call and we will help you out.
